What Is a Chain Conveyor for Heavy-Duty Material Conveying?

A chain conveyor is a type of conveyor system that uses chains as the driving and transporting mechanism instead of belts or rollers. The conveyor typically consists of one or multiple chains driven by motors and sprockets. Heavy materials are placed directly on the chains or on fixtures attached to the chains.
Compared with other conveyor systems, chain conveyors are ideal for:
- Heavy products
- High-temperature environments
- Long-term continuous operation
- Pallet conveying
- Automated assembly lines
- Precision positioning applications
Because of their strong structural design, chain conveyors can transport products ranging from 100 kg to several tons.
Core Components of a Heavy-Duty Chain Conveyor
The performance of a chain conveyor depends heavily on the quality and design of its components.
1. Conveyor Chains
The chain is the core component responsible for carrying and moving the load.
Common chain pitch specifications include:
| Chain Pitch | Typical Application | Load Capacity |
|---|---|---|
| P=38.1 mm | Medium-duty conveying | Moderate |
| P=50.8 mm | Heavy industrial products | High |
| P=100 mm | Ultra-heavy pallet conveying | Extremely High |
Different chain materials are selected according to the operating environment.
| Chain Material | Features | Suitable Applications |
|---|---|---|
| Carbon Steel Nickel-Plated | High strength and wear resistance | Standard heavy-duty conveying |
| Stainless Steel | Corrosion resistance | Food, pharmaceutical, humid environments |
| Engineering Plastic | Lightweight and low noise | Light-duty industrial transport |
2. Drive Motor System
The drive motor provides power for chain movement.
Common drive configurations include:
- Single-chain drive
- Double-chain drive
- Multi-chain parallel drive
Servo motors can also be integrated for high-precision positioning applications.
3. Sprockets
Sprockets engage directly with conveyor chains to ensure stable movement. Precision-machined sprockets reduce chain wear and improve synchronization.
4. Conveyor Frame
The frame supports the entire conveyor system and heavy loads.
Common materials include:
- Carbon steel
- Stainless steel
- Aluminum alloy for lightweight applications
Heavy-duty frames are often reinforced to withstand long-term high-load operation.

5. Guide Rails and Support Structures
Guide rails maintain product stability during transportation, especially for large pallets or unstable loads.

Working Principle of Chain Conveyor Systems
The working principle of a heavy-duty chain conveyor is straightforward but highly reliable.
- The motor drives the sprocket.
- The sprocket pulls the conveyor chain.
- The chain transports products along the conveyor path.
- Sensors monitor product position and movement.
- Control systems coordinate speed, stopping, accumulation, and transfer operations.
Because the chains are mechanically linked, the conveyor can move extremely heavy products with excellent stability.
Typical conveying speed ranges from:
v=2 to 15 m/minv=2\text{ to }15\ \mathrm{m/min}
This relatively slow speed is intentional because heavy-duty applications prioritize stability and safety over high-speed transportation.

Competitive Analysis: Chain Conveyor vs Other Conveying Systems
Chain Conveyor vs Belt Conveyor
| Factor | Chain Conveyor | Belt Conveyor |
|---|---|---|
| Load Capacity | Extremely High | Moderate |
| Durability | Excellent | Good |
| Heavy Pallet Handling | Excellent | Limited |
| High Temperature Resistance | Strong | Weak |
| Precision Positioning | Better | Moderate |
| Maintenance | Moderate | Lower |
| Cost | Higher Initial Cost | Lower Initial Cost |
Chain conveyors are clearly superior for heavy-duty industrial applications.
Chain Conveyor vs Roller Conveyor
| Factor | Chain Conveyor | Roller Conveyor |
|---|---|---|
| Heavy Load Capability | Stronger | Moderate |
| Stability | Excellent | Good |
| Inclined Conveying | Better | Limited |
| Precision Control | Higher | Moderate |
| Automation Compatibility | Excellent | Good |
Chain Conveyor vs Forklift Transportation
| Factor | Chain Conveyor | Forklift |
|---|---|---|
| Automation | Fully Automatic | Manual |
| Safety | Higher | Lower |
| Continuous Operation | Excellent | Limited |
| Labor Requirement | Low | High |
| Long-Term Cost | Lower | Higher |

Maintenance Tips for Long-Term Operation
Proper maintenance extends conveyor lifespan and reduces downtime.
Recommended Maintenance Practices
| Maintenance Item | Recommendation |
|---|---|
| Chain Lubrication | Regular inspection |
| Sprocket Wear Check | Monthly |
| Motor Inspection | Quarterly |
| Sensor Cleaning | Weekly |
| Chain Tension Adjustment | As Needed |
Preventive maintenance is essential for maintaining stable heavy-duty operation.
